Why calcuim cyanamide can be used as a fertiliser ?

Text Solution

Verified by Experts

Calcium cyanamide, `CaCN_2` reacts with atmospheric `CO_2` and moisture resulting in the formation of urea , which further decomposes to give ammonia. `NH_3` is assimilated by plants and that is how calcium cyanamide acts as a fertiliser.
`CaCN_2 + 2H_2O + CO_2 rarr NH_2 CONH_2 + CaCO_3`
`underset (Urea) NH_2 CONH_2 + H_2 O rarr 2 NH_3 + CO_2`.
